Stretching across Japan’s tranquil Inland Sea, the Setouchi region is a tapestry of islands and coastal retreats where history, nature, art, and living traditions intertwine. From ancient archaeological sites to world-class contemporary design, Setouchi offers travellers a wealth of experiences beyond the country’s better-known cities. Among its many highlights are the islands of Ieshima, Iwaishima, Shōdoshima, and Naoshima, along with the newly renovated Kyukamura Sanuki Goshikidai on Shikoku’s Goshikidai Plateau — together showcasing the diverse culture and lifestyle of this unique region.
